Biography

Julián E. Sánchez-Velandia currently work as a posdoctoral researcher in the supramolecular and sustainable chemistry research group at the Universidad Jaume I (Castellon de la Plana- Spain). He is enjoying a fellowship from the Universidad Jaume I and work in the field of advanced inorganic materials, computational chemistry, monoterpenes transformation and chemistry in flow. Also he works in collaboration with different research groups and universities around the world: Universidad Politécnica de Valencia (Valencia/Spain), Abo akademi University (Turku, Finland), Institute of chemistry of new materials (Belarus), Universidad de Antioquia (Medellín, Colombia), Universidad Industrial de Santander (Bucaramanga, Colombia).
